Transponder chip

Transponder chips add an additional layer of protection to your vehicle. These chips transmit a coded message that can only be read by the anti-theft system of your car. They were invented by GM and were first utilized in 1985 on the Corvette. Since then, they have been employed by the majority of major automakers. The transponder, a chip in your car key, stores a unique "password" for your vehicle. When the key is inserted into the ignition barrel an induction coil sends an audio signal to the transponder. This energy will then power the microchip causing it to transmit a coded response. The engine will start when the code matches that stored in the anti-theft device of the car.

The primary purpose of the car transponder chip is to deter theft. Unlike traditional mechanical keys, which are easily duplicated, transponder chips are difficult to duplicate. They require special programming procedures and a computer with the capability to locate the password. Without this technology, your car won't start, leaving you in a secluded spot.

Key code

Key codes are an alphanumeric code that is sometimes seen printed on keys or locks. They can be numbers that correspond with the factory depths for the cuts on a lock or key or codes to obscure keys and only allow one cut. These codes may also be written on locks to let the locksmith know what kind of blank key they will need to purchase for a client. The code is usually composed of numbers and letters but it could also be any combination of characters. Some manufacturers use this information to shield the keys they make from copying by someone else.

Key code numbers are usually only visible to those who have access to the software. This means only professional locksmiths can reprogram car keys or clone transponder chips using this method. Security light

The security light on your car will illuminate when the anti-theft system is working properly. The system won't allow the car to start if you attempt to start it using a key that isn't paired with the correct immobilizer. The security indicator also illuminates when the ignition is off. This alerts you that the vehicle is not secured.

If you lose the spare key for your vauxhall meriva car key replacement Astra K, Viva/Mokka or Viva/Mokka, you will have to visit a main dealer in order to obtain the immobiliser/security code. The technician will program the code using an TECH-2 tool or a similar. In the past the security code was given to you with your Service Book pack as what was known as a "Car Pass', however this is no longer the case and the security code is accessed directly by the main dealer.
